Situated in the historic Yentna Mining District, Cache Creek Cabins are part of a patented gold claim that dates back to some of the earliest gold mining activity, in 1906. Our scenic location is less then ten air miles from the southern edge of Denali National Park, and offers incredible views of all the beauty the Alaska wilderness has to offer.
Pan for gold, pick berries, hike, fish for native rainbow trout and greyling, or view wildlife. (It is not uncommon to see bear and moose from the cabins.)
